True Position Calculator
True Position Calculator
Results
Precise dimensional control forms the foundation of reliable construction, manufacturing, and engineering. When verifying the location of features like bolt holes, anchors, or pins, simple X and Y measurements are insufficient for communicating or inspecting functional fit. The concept of true position, a fundamental principle of Geometric Dimensioning and Tolerancing (GD&T), addresses this need by defining a cylindrical tolerance zone around a theoretically exact location. A True Position Calculator automates the vectorial deviation calculation required to determine if a produced feature lies within its specified tolerance zone, converting coordinate measurements into a single, actionable result.
Defining True Position and Its Practical Purpose
Within the ASME Y14.5 and ISO GPS standards, true position is the theoretically perfect location of a feature, established by basic dimensions from specified datums. Position tolerance, symbolized by a diameter symbol (⌀) preceding the tolerance value in a feature control frame, defines the diameter of a cylindrical zone within which the feature’s axis or center point must lie. This three-dimensional cylindrical zone is fundamentally different from a simple plus/minus rectangular tolerance zone, as it allows twice as much tolerance diagonally while providing stricter control directionally.
Construction engineers, machinists, and quality inspectors use a True Position Calculator to translate physical measurements into a compliance check against this cylindrical zone. During the layout of anchor bolts for a structural steel column, for instance, the designed positions are the true positions. After installation, surveyors measure the actual coordinates of each bolt. The calculator processes the deviations to confirm the entire bolt group pattern complies with the structural drawings, ensuring steel members will fit without field modification. In CNC machining, a quality report uses true position calculations to verify that a drilled hole pattern for a mounting plate is within the print’s specified positional tolerance, guaranteeing assembly with mating parts.
Differences Between 2D and 3D True Position Calculations
A 2D true position calculation measures deviation in a single plane, typically the X and Y axes. It is applied to features like holes or pins on a flat surface where the depth or height is not a controlled feature of the callout.
A 3D true position calculation adds a Z-axis deviation, accounting for volumetric error. The Z-axis value is used when the geometric control frame on the drawing includes a depth modifier, such as "ø .010Ⓜ︎|A|B|C". The third datum (C) often establishes the depth or height constraint, making the Z-coordinate measurement necessary.
The true position result is always multiplied by 2. This is derived from the standard GD&T formula, which calculates radial error. The measured deviations (ΔX, ΔY, ΔZ) are linear distances from the true position. Doubling their combined radial distance reports the full diameter of the tolerance zone within which the feature's axis lies.
Mapping Inputs to the GD&T Formula
The formula is: TP = 2 × √((ΔX)² + (ΔY)² + (ΔZ)²)
Actual X and Y (and Z): These are the measured coordinates of the feature's axis. Their difference from the Theoretical X and Y (and Z)—the designed nominal coordinates—provides the ΔX, ΔY, and ΔZ values for the equation.
True Position Tolerance: This is the specified diameter of the tolerance zone from the drawing (e.g., ø0.010). It is not a direct input to the core deviation calculation but is the benchmark against which the calculated TP result is compared to determine conformance.
The Mathematical Foundation: Formula and Variables
The true position calculation is an application of the Pythagorean theorem in a coordinate plane. The formula computes the radial deviation of a feature’s actual location from its true (nominal) location.
Formula: True Position Deviation (TP) = 2 * √[(ΔX)² + (ΔY)²]
Where:
- ΔX (X Deviation): The difference between the measured X coordinate and the nominal X coordinate. Units are consistent (millimeters or inches).
- ΔY (Y Deviation): The difference between the measured Y coordinate and the nominal Y coordinate.
The Result (TP): The calculated diametral deviation—the diameter of the smallest circle that can be centered on the nominal position and still contain the actual measured position. This output is directly comparable to the positional tolerance callout on a drawing.
Critical Assumptions and Context
The formula assumes a Cartesian coordinate system defined by the referenced datums (e.g., Datum A for origin, Datum B for orientation). Measurements must be taken within this established system. It applies to the axis of a feature of size (like a hole) or the center point of a spherical feature. The “2” multiplier converts the radial error (the hypotenuse) into a diametral value, matching the cylindrical tolerance zone diameter specified in the feature control frame. When a maximum material condition (MMC) modifier is applied to the tolerance in the drawing, bonus tolerance may be permissible, a complication most basic calculators do not handle automatically and requires manual adjustment of the allowable tolerance.
How to Use the True Position Calculator
- Determine Coordinate Deviations: Subtract the nominal (design) coordinate from the measured coordinate for each axis. Calculate ΔX = Measured X − Nominal X and ΔY = Measured Y − Nominal Y. Calculate ΔZ only if a 3D evaluation is required.
- Select Measurement Type: Choose 2D for planar position checks using X and Y, or 3D if Z deviation must be included.
- Enter Deviations: Input the calculated ΔX and ΔY values. Enter ΔZ only when using 3D mode.
- Set Positional Tolerance: Enter the diametral positional tolerance specified on the drawing.
- Apply Bonus Tolerance if Applicable: Add any allowable bonus tolerance resulting from maximum material condition.
- Run Calculation: Submit the form to compute true position deviation and compare it against the effective tolerance.
Common Mistakes
The most frequent errors include swapping nominal and measured values (which doesn’t change the absolute result but can confuse directional analysis), using inconsistent units, and forgetting to account for datum reference frames that are not aligned with the measurement coordinate system. Always verify the measurement coordinate system matches the drawing’s datum scheme.
Interpreting Calculator Results and Determining Compliance
The calculator’s output is a single number: the calculated true position deviation. Interpretation is straightforward but must be contextual.
Pass/Fail Criterion: If the calculated deviation is less than or equal to the specified positional tolerance on the drawing, the feature passes. If the calculated deviation exceeds the specified tolerance, the feature fails inspection.
A calculated true position of 0.42 mm against a specified tolerance of ⌀ 0.5 mm indicates acceptance. The 0.42 mm represents the diameter of the cylinder needed to contain the axis; since it is smaller than the allowed 0.5 mm cylinder, the part is good. This result is directly reported on inspection documents, often alongside a graphical deviation chart. For a construction layout, passing results for all anchor bolts mean the foundation is ready for steel erection without shimming or drilling. A failing result necessitates corrective action, such as relocating a bolt or, in machining, potentially scrapping the part.
Comparisons with Related Measurement Concepts
True Position vs. Basic Coordinate Measurement: Simple plus/minus tolerancing creates a rectangular tolerance zone. A point measuring 0.35 mm off in both X and Y would pass a ±0.5 mm square zone but fails a ⌀ 0.5 mm cylindrical true position zone, as the diagonal deviation is ~0.495 mm radially, resulting in a ~0.99 mm diametral calculation. True position more accurately reflects functional fit where direction of error is less critical than overall location.
True Position vs. Concentricity: True position controls the location of a feature’s axis relative to datums. Concentricity, a rarely used and more complex tolerance, controls the coincidence of axes and is concerned with the median points of a feature’s surface. Position is almost always preferred for its clarity and easier verification.
Relationship to Standards: The calculator implements the core mathematical rule from ASME Y14.5 and ISO 1101. However, professional application requires understanding the full standard, including modifiers like MMC, datum precedence, and composite tolerances, which govern how the basic formula is applied.
Limitations, Assumptions, and Critical Edge Cases
A basic True Position Calculator has significant operational boundaries. It does not automatically apply geometric tolerance modifiers like MMC or LMC, where the allowable tolerance can increase as the feature size departs from its material condition limit. This must be calculated separately. The calculator also assumes perfect measurement input; it cannot account for the uncertainty of the coordinate measuring machine (CMM), laser tracker, or tape measure used. A 0.001 mm measurement error directly propagates into the result.
Edge cases reveal system limits. If both ΔX and ΔY are zero, true position is zero, indicating perfect location. If the positional tolerance on the drawing is extremely large relative to the basic dimensions, the tolerance zone may extend beyond the part’s boundaries, which is nonsensical and indicates a drawing error. Perhaps the most consequential edge case involves a misaligned measurement coordinate system. If the physical part is misaligned on a CMM or the field layout is not properly oriented to the survey control, all calculated true position values will be invalid, even if the internal pattern of features is perfect. The calculator processes numbers blindly; establishing the correct datum reference frame is the inspector’s responsibility.
Real-World Calculation Examples
Example 1: Anchor Bolt Layout Inspection
A foundation drawing specifies four anchor bolts at nominal positions relative to column centerlines: Bolt A at (100 mm, 100 mm) with a positional tolerance of ⌀ 8 mm. Field survey measures Bolt A at (101.5 mm, 99.0 mm).
ΔX = 101.5 – 100 = 1.5 mm
ΔY = 99.0 – 100 = -1.0 mm
True Position = 2 * √[(1.5)² + (-1.0)²] = 2 * √[2.25 + 1.0] = 2 * √3.25 = 2 * 1.803 = 3.606 mm.
Interpretation: 3.606 mm < 8 mm tolerance. Bolt A passes. The construction crew has placed this bolt well within the allowable zone for erecting the steel column.
Example 2: Machined Bracket Hole Inspection
A machined aluminum bracket has a locating pin hole with nominal position (50.00 mm, 25.00 mm) from datums and a tight positional tolerance of ⌀ 0.10 mm. CMM measurement finds the hole center at (50.07 mm, 24.97 mm).
ΔX = 50.07 – 50.00 = 0.07 mm
ΔY = 24.97 – 25.00 = -0.03 mm
True Position = 2 * √[(0.07)² + (-0.03)²] = 2 * √[0.0049 + 0.0009] = 2 * √0.0058 = 2 * 0.0762 = 0.1524 mm.
Interpretation: 0.1524 mm > 0.10 mm tolerance. The hole fails inspection. The radial error of 0.0762 mm exceeds the allowed 0.05 mm radial zone. This part would likely be rejected, prompting a review of the CNC drilling process.
Data Privacy and Security in Calculation Tools
Most web-based True Position Calculators operate client-side within your browser; the input numbers are not transmitted to a server for processing. This local execution provides a basic level of data security, as proprietary coordinate data never leaves your local machine. However, users must verify the calculator’s functionality by testing with known values. For highly sensitive proprietary components or classified projects, the safest protocol is to use a verified formula within a local spreadsheet or dedicated metrology software, ensuring no data is exposed to any network. The user bears ultimate responsibility for protecting design and measurement data when using any online tool.
Frequently Asked Questions
What is the difference between true position and linear dimensions with ± tolerances?
True position defines a cylindrical tolerance zone using a single diametral value, controlling the combined effect of deviations in all directions perpendicular to the datum axis. Plus/minus tolerancing creates a rectangular zone, treating X and Y deviations independently, which can allow a feature that is far off diagonally to still pass.
Does the True Position Calculator work for threaded holes and press-fit pins?
Yes, it applies to any feature of size where a center point or axis can be established. The same formula is used. The inspection method for finding that axis (using pin gages, CMM probes, or optical comparators) will vary based on the feature type.
When should I use true position instead of concentricity or runout?
True position is the primary choice for controlling location. Concentricity, which controls the derived median points of a surface, is notoriously difficult and expensive to measure and is avoided in modern GD&T. Runout controls surface variation during rotation and is more about form and orientation than pure location.
How does measurement system error affect my true position result?
All measurement devices have inherent uncertainty. This error band is added to your calculated deviation, effectively consuming part of your allowable tolerance. For a tight tolerance like ⌀ 0.05 mm, using a measurement tool with ±0.01 mm uncertainty significantly impacts the reliability of your pass/fail decision.
Can true position be applied to a pattern of holes as a group?
Yes. Composite position tolerance or a pattern-locating control can be specified on a drawing. In this case, each hole’s position is calculated relative to the datums, but the pattern as a unit must also maintain its overall location and orientation. This requires analyzing the results as a set, not just as individual calculations.
Does the concept of true position exist outside of formal GD&T?
The mathematical principle of calculating radial deviation from a nominal point is universal. While the term "true position" and its strict interpretation are tied to ASME/ISO standards, the practice of verifying location within a circular zone is common in surveying, PCB fabrication, and other fields, even if not formally called GD&T.